Title: Joerg Kaufmann: Innovator in Signal Modulation Techniques
Introduction
Joerg Kaufmann is a notable inventor based in Iffeldorf, Germany. He has made significant contributions to the field of interaction assays, particularly in methods for modulating signal intensity. His innovative approaches have the potential to enhance the accuracy and efficiency of various analytical processes.
Latest Patents
Kaufmann holds a patent for "Methods for modulating signal intensity in interaction assays." This patent includes a method for determining an analyte in a sample by contacting it with an interaction modulator. The interaction modulators mentioned in the patent include Poly-(4-styrenesulfonic acid-co-maleic acid) (PSSM), aminodextran, carboxymethyldextran, Poly-(2-acrylamido-2-methyl-1-propanesulfonic acid (PAMPS), triethylamine, triethanolamine, taurine, and dodecylsulfate. The method is designed to enhance the interaction assay at low analyte concentrations while acting as a retarder at high concentrations. Additionally, the patent describes a kit that includes a detection agent specifically for the analyte and at least one interaction modulator, along with devices related to these methods and kits.
Career Highlights
Kaufmann is currently employed at Roche Diagnostics Operations, Inc., where he continues to develop innovative solutions in the field of diagnostics. His work focuses on improving the methodologies used in interaction assays, which are crucial for various applications in medical and scientific research.
Collaborations
Throughout his career, Kaufmann has collaborated with esteemed colleagues such as Georg Kurz and Eloisa Lopez-Calle. These collaborations have contributed to the advancement of his research and the successful development of his patented technologies.
